VeriDoc Global is a SaaS technology company that provides a blockchain-based document verification platform. Its system uses QR code authentication to prevent fraud and ensure tamper-proof data integrity. The platform has secured over 1.45 million data points and is trusted across 22 or more countries. It serves sectors including government, banking, education, pharma, healthcare, supply chain, food and beverage, and real estate, with a stated mission of enabling an honest and transparent future.

VeriDoc Global enables organizations to secure documents using blockchain verification combined with QR code authentication. When a document is issued through the platform, a QR code is embedded that links to a tamper-proof blockchain record. Recipients or verifiers can instantly authenticate the document by scanning the QR code, confirming data integrity and preventing fraud. The platform is designed to work across industries such as government, banking, education, healthcare, supply chain, food and beverage, and real estate.
